Abstract

The paper deals with the analysis of the main perspectives of green investments market functioning in Ukraine. The dynamic and tendency of functioning of the Ukrainian and EU green market investment market were analysed. In the paper the main approaches to defining green investment, principals and features of green investment market functioning were consolidated. Besides, the main players and its roles were indicated in the paper by the author. The results of analysis of the Ukrainian green investment market functioning showed that the main barriers which restrict the developing were: insufficient of the legal basis; misunderstanding of the main features of green investment among investors; the lack of government support in Ukraine and etc. In the paper, the main categories of green investment were
summarised. The conceptual framework of transformation from traditional to green investment market in Ukraine was proposed. With the purpose to indicate the main directions for developing the Ukrainian green investment market, the European Union experience of green investment market functioning were analysed. The findings showed that the most attractive directions for green investment are clean energy and green securities. In this case, the dynamic of green bonds market was analysed. On the basis of the findings the main attractive directions for green investment in Ukraine were indicated.
